Job description

Located in Largo in the heart of Prince George’s County, our new state-of-the-art regional medical center (UM Capital Region Medical Center) will provide improved access to primary and ambulatory care services, and serve as a tertiary care center for critically ill patients. In addition, our new space will allow us to expand our offerings as a community partner to help improve the health status of Prince George’s County residents.

Job Description

Job specifics :

  • Join a multifaceted team that covers neurosurgery, neurocritical care, and elective neurosurgery cases.

The Advanced Practice Practitioner’s (APP) primary role will cover neurosurgery

  • The APP will be trained to cover all aspects of the neuroscience team.
  • The APP will have the opportunity to train and cross cover other APP lead service lines.
  • Help ensure full coverage of the neuroscience clinical schedule.
  • Performs routine and expanded job descriptions as listed in the provider's delegation agreement on file with the Maryland Board of Physicians or Maryland Board of Nursing. In collaboration with the physician care team, the APP will :
  • Provide diagnostic, therapeutic, and preventive health care services to critically ill patients.

  • Obtain medical histories, examines patients, rounds daily, orders and interprets tests, makes initial diagnoses, and orders treatments.
  • Communicate effectively with attending physicians, other medical teams, team members, and patients and their families.
  • Administer therapeutic procedures such as placement of intracranial monitoring systems, extra ventricular drains, VP shunt taps, suturing, and wound care.
  • Instructs and counsels patients and families.
  • May first assist in the operating room when necessary.
